I stayed here for 4 months while working on a job site. Mr and Mrs Z are super nice folks. And very helpful if you need anything. The neighbors which some live here are very nice people too. It's only a few miles from the lake Murray if love to fish, the lake is full of striped bass! This is a great place to stay, whether it's long term or overnight. If I'm back in this area it's the only place I'll stay. I could go on about how much I loved staying here, but I think you get the picture.
